Mission

Mission Vineyard is a relevant church making a transformational impact on the neighborhood while serving the needs of people throughout all spectrums of poverty including spiritual, physical and material.

Sector benchmark

What Religion-Related executives earn in Texas

Mission Vineyard reported no executive compensation in its latest filing. For context, the highest-paid executive at a comparable religion-related organization in Texas earns a median of $50,000.

25th percentile
$23k
Median
$50,000
75th percentile
$86k
90th percentile
$144k

These are religion-related sector-wide figures, not this organization's reported pay. Based on 1,309 organizations across 1,309 filings (2021 – 2024).
